Transaction 80df61395d974d788ea9c2bfce7e73690bdeaf3966628d8e95f32eb17af6e897
1 Input
1 Output
-
80df61395d974d788ea9c2bfce7e73690bdeaf3966628d8e95f32eb17af6e897:0
- value
- 1971591
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dbcf21e3ee71dc15e90d0b05459b73506537bee OP_EQUAL
- address
- 3LSro3wZyXEnz68CPETPP2ZJgY8rMAP7ES